It is best to use wood that has been seasoned for your garden log burner. This means that the wood has been dried over a long period of time. This process, also known as seasoning, assists in reduce the moisture content of the wood down to a level more suitable for burning. Green or unseasoned wood can cause a variety of issues, ranging from dampness and mildew to the formation of creosote inside the flue pipe.

If you do not have the time or the patience to season your own wood, there are many ready-to-savor logs that are available from the majority of supermarkets and timber dealers. Easy to maintain

A wood burner that is rusted can be more than just unattractive. It could also be a safety and health hazard. Rust can quickly spread when exposed to humidity and rain so keeping your outdoor stove clean or the chimenea in good condition is crucial.

It is easy to keep your outdoor wood-burning stove in good condition by checking it regularly and wiping away any ash or dust that has accumulated. This can be accomplished easily with a vacuum or soft brush attachments. Regularly checking it will ensure that there is no damage.

Make sure that the stove is completely cool before you begin cleaning. This will give you a better chance of removing any leftover ash which you can scoop into a bucket made from metal. wood stove burning is recommended to wear protective gloves since some types of ash can be extremely abrasive. After removing the ash, you should dispose of it outside and away from combustible substances. Some people add wood Ash to provide potassium and lime to their garden compost.

It is easy to clean the glass on your wood-burning stove simply by dipping the newspaper in water before rub it against the glass. This will remove any dirt buildup and be followed by a wipe down with a dry, clean cloth. You could also add a small amount of vinegar to the water if you wish to make the glass of your wood stove to shine. It is essential not to use anything too abrasive, as this could scratch the surface of the glass and make it less safe to use.
